mIxED MeDia: 

-When more than one medium is employed in a piece ofVisual Art Work.

(-Not to be confused with Multi Media (Which might combine music/

literature/ performance outside the realm of “    Visual Art.”     )

-There are other

techniques we can

employ too:•Burn/ Rip pages

•Stamping/ or applying a print

to to the page

•Incorporating tracings

•Collage (pasting cut out

paper to make a new image)

•Decoupage (cover with

decoupage glue of a glossyeffect.

•Gel transfer: makes a photo

appear faintly on the work.

What makes for good m ixed media pieces?

-Work is well balanced: has thoughtfully balancedcolor/line/texture. Piece registers from a distance.

-Work has a focal point and purposefully directsthe viewer around the composition.

-Artist seamlessly integrates the media. (No visual

speed bumps. 

)

-Artist has technical command and confidence

with the media employed.

Tips:

Keep an archive of materials. Play with them! (This is the

way of the mixed media artist)

-Experiment Scientifically. (Keep track of your methods andstart with three media at the most. Figure out one thing at a time and

stick with what works.)

-Go thin to fat. ( washes, glazes and gel transfers are better for the

background. Heavier materials like decoupaged tissue go on top.)

-Go Beyond the surface. ( Pull the audience in using the

 principles of depth (warm colors come forward, cool recede.

Relationships of size can be used as well)
